So konvertieren Sie OXPS mit GroupDocs.Conversion für .NET in PPT: Eine Schritt-für-Schritt-Anleitung
Einführung
Haben Sie Schwierigkeiten, Ihre OXPS-Dateien in PowerPoint-Präsentationen (PPT) zu konvertieren? Angesichts des wachsenden Bedarfs an nahtloser Dokumentformatkonvertierung bietet GroupDocs.Conversion für .NET eine effiziente Lösung. Diese Anleitung führt Sie durch die Konvertierung von OXPS in PPT mithilfe der leistungsstarken GroupDocs.Conversion-Bibliothek.
Was Sie lernen werden:
- Einrichten und Konfigurieren von GroupDocs.Conversion in Ihrem .NET-Projekt
- Schritt-für-Schritt-Anleitung zum Laden einer OXPS-Datei
- Konvertieren von OXPS in PowerPoint (PPT) mit ausführlichen Codebeispielen
- Best Practices zur Leistungsoptimierung während der Konvertierung
Beginnen wir mit der Klärung der Voraussetzungen.
Voraussetzungen
Bevor wir beginnen, stellen Sie sicher, dass Sie Folgendes eingerichtet haben:
Erforderliche Bibliotheken und Abhängigkeiten:
- GroupDocs.Conversion für .NET (Version 25.3.0)
Anforderungen für die Umgebungseinrichtung:
- Eine Entwicklungsumgebung mit installiertem .NET Framework oder .NET Core
- Visual Studio oder jede kompatible IDE
Erforderliche Kenntnisse:
- Grundlegende Kenntnisse der C#-Programmierung
- Vertrautheit mit der Dateiverwaltung in .NET
Einrichten von GroupDocs.Conversion für .NET
Um zu beginnen, müssen Sie die Bibliothek GroupDocs.Conversion installieren. So geht’s:
NuGet-Paket-Manager-Konsole:
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ET-CLI:
dotnet add package GroupDocs.Conversion --version 25.3.0
Schritte zum Lizenzerwerb
- Kostenlose Testversion: Beginnen Sie mit einer kostenlosen Testversion, um die grundlegenden Funktionen kennenzulernen.
- Temporäre Lizenz: Für längere Tests erwerben Sie eine temporäre Lizenz von Gruppendokumente.
- Kaufen: Erwägen Sie den Erwerb einer Volllizenz für den Produktionseinsatz unter GroupDocs-Kauf.
Nach der Installation und Lizenzierung können Sie die Bibliothek in Ihrem C#-Projekt wie folgt initialisieren:
using GroupDocs.Conversion;
// Initialisieren des Konvertierungshandlers
var converter = new Converter("sample.oxps");
Implementierungshandbuch
Nachdem Sie nun alles eingerichtet haben, schauen wir uns an, wie Sie die Konvertierung von OXPS in PPT implementieren.
Laden einer OXPS-Datei
Überblick:
Der erste Schritt besteht darin, Ihre OXPS-Quelldatei in die GroupDocs.Conversion-Bibliothek zu laden.
Schritt 1: Definieren Sie Ihr Dokumentverzeichnis
string inputDirectory = @"YOUR_DOCUMENT_DIRECTORY";
string sampleOxpsFile = Path.Combine(inputDirectory, "sample.oxps"); // Ersetzen Sie durch Ihren tatsächlichen OXPS-Dateinamen
Schritt 2: Laden Sie die Quelldatei
So können Sie eine OXPS-Datei laden:
using (var converter = new GroupDocs.Conversion.Converter(sampleOxpsFile))
{
// Das Konverterobjekt ist nun betriebsbereit.
}
- Parameter: Pfad zu Ihrer OXPS-Datei.
- Zweck: Lädt das Dokument und ermöglicht Konvertierungsaktionen.
Konvertieren von OXPS in PPT
Überblick:
Nach dem Laden können Sie Ihre OXPS-Datei mithilfe spezieller Konvertierungsoptionen in eine PowerPoint-Präsentation konvertieren.
Schritt 1: Ausgabeverzeichnis und Datei definieren
string outputDirectory = @"Y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putDirectory, "oxps-converted-to.ppt");
Schritt 2: Konvertierungsoptionen festlegen
Konfigurieren Sie Ihre Konvertierungseinstellungen für das PowerPoint-Format:
PresentationConvertOptions options = new PresentationConvertOptions { Format = PresentationFileType.Ppt };
- Zweck: Gibt das gewünschte Ausgabeformat an.
Schritt 3: Führen Sie die Konvertierung durch Führen Sie die Konvertierung durch und speichern Sie die PPT-Datei:
using (var converter = new GroupDocs.Conversion.Converter(sampleOxpsFile))
{
converter.Convert(outputFile, options);
}
// Die konvertierte PPT wird jetzt in Ihrem angegebenen Ausgabeverzeichnis gespeichert.
- Parameter: Pfad zur Ausgabedatei und Konvertierungseinstellungen.
- Tipp zur Fehlerbehebung: Stellen Sie sicher, dass die Pfade richtig eingestellt sind, um Folgendes zu vermeiden:
FileNotFoundException
.
Praktische Anwendungen
GroupDocs.Conversion für .NET kann in verschiedene Anwendungen integriert werden:
- Dokumentenmanagementsysteme: Automatisieren Sie Formatkonvertierungen für gespeicherte Dokumente.
- Tools zur Inhaltserstellung: Ermöglichen Sie Benutzern das Konvertieren von OXPS-Dateien in Designsoftware.
- Cloud-Dienste: Implementieren Sie Konvertierungsfunktionen in Cloud-basierten Dokumentdiensten.
Überlegungen zur Leistung
Beachten Sie bei der Verwendung von GroupDocs.Conversion diese Leistungstipps:
- Optimieren Sie die Speichernutzung durch die sofortige Entsorgung von Objekten mit
using
Aussagen. - Verwalten Sie Ressourcen effizient, um große Dokumente ohne Verzögerung zu verarbeiten.
- Befolgen Sie die Best Practices von .NET für die Speicherverwaltung bei intensiven Konvertierungen.
Abschluss
Mit dieser Anleitung können Sie nun OXPS-Dateien mit GroupDocs.Conversion in Ihren .NET-Anwendungen in PPT konvertieren. Diese Funktion verbessert Ihre Dokumentenverwaltung erheblich und optimiert Arbeitsabläufe. Wenn Sie mehr erfahren möchten, sollten Sie sich auch mit anderen von GroupDocs unterstützten Konvertierungsformaten befassen.
Nächste Schritte: Experimentieren Sie mit verschiedenen Dateitypen oder integrieren Sie zusätzliche Funktionen wie die Stapelverarbeitung.
FAQ-Bereich
Was ist OXPS?
- OXPS steht für Open XML Paper Specification und wird für Dokumente mit festem Layout verwendet.
Kann ich mehrere Dateien gleichzeitig konvertieren?
- Während sich dieses Handbuch auf die Konvertierung einzelner Dateien bezieht, können Sie Schleifen zur Stapelverarbeitung implementieren.
Fallen für die Nutzung von GroupDocs.Conversion Kosten an?
- Eine kostenlose Testversion ist verfügbar. Für die weitere Nutzung über diesen Zeitraum hinaus ist ein Kauf erforderlich.
Wie behebe ich Probleme bei fehlgeschlagenen Konvertierungen?
- Überprüfen Sie die Dateipfade und stellen Sie sicher, dass Ihre Umgebung alle Voraussetzungen erfüllt.
Welche anderen Formate kann ich mit GroupDocs.Conversion konvertieren?
- Unterstützt eine Vielzahl von Dokumentformaten, darunter PDF, Word, Excel und mehr.